Ability: My Best Shot

Color: Red
AP Cost: 6

Spider-Man lets loose a cosmic blast coupled with his already Amazing strength. Select a 3×3 block, then deal 2908 damage and create 2 Web tiles within the block and convert existing Web tiles in the block into Critical tiles.

(PASSIVE) When Spider-Man makes a match, create 1 Web tile (up to 3). Web tiles matched or destroyed by allies deal an additional 1071 damage.

Ability: With Ultimate Power

Color: Yellow
AP Cost: 7

With the power granted by the Enigma force, Peter Parker takes on the mantle of Captain Universe. Create 5 random Web tiles.

(PASSIVE) When an ally would take ability damage, remove a Web tile to reduce the damage by 20%. When there are 5 or more Web tiles on the board, this ability becomes Ultimate Responsibility.

Ability: Ultimate Responsibility

Color: Yellow
AP Cost: 7

With these new powers, Spider-Man defends his entire reality. Convert 5 Web tiles into Critical tiles, deal 5051 team damage, and Stun the enemy team for 1 turn.

(PASSIVE) Allies take 20% reduced damage and deal 2602 damage when they take ability damage. When there are less than 5 Web tiles on the board, this ability becomes With Ultimate Power…

Ability: Not the Same Spider-Man

Color: Purple
AP Cost: 7

Spider-Man changes the very molecular structure of the matter around him. Select 2 tiles and convert up to 2 tiles around each into the same color and any Web tiles into Critical tiles, then deal 2449 damage.

(PASSIVE) Every 2 turn(s), at the start of Spider-Man’s turn, Create 1 Web tile, adjacent to an enemy special tile if able.

    With just 1 Red cover he will be incredibly dangerous with spammy web tile partners (looking at you 2099) because for 6 AP he will be turning a whole bunch of web tiles into critical tiles.

    Even the passive on the Red will deal a lot of extra damage when you match/destroy web tiles (makes Silk a nice partner too since she will be constantly destroying web tiles triggering his passive damage).

    He's going to be a beast compared to Galactus. Of course he lacks any defense against stun/away/airborne so winfintes should take him down quick.
